débloquer

unblock

verb deh-bloh-KEH Rare

Also means

unlock

Usage Note

Débloquer covers both physical unblocking (clearing a jam) and figurative unblocking (releasing funds, breaking a deadlock). In informal slang, il débloque means 'he's talking nonsense' or 'he's lost it'. The opposite is bloquer.

Examples

"Il faut débloquer la situation rapidement."

Natural Translation

The situation needs to be unblocked quickly.
